Questions

# The things people ask me first.

If your question is not here, ask it in the consultation. Nothing is too small to bring up.

![Soft morning fog resting over still water](/assets/card-fog-Bz_iHxke.jpg)

### How does payment work?

This is a private-pay practice. Fees are $150 for a 60-minute session and $400 for an ART intensive, and payment is due in full at the time of booking.

### Do you provide documentation for my own records?

Yes. You may request access to your treatment records. If you need a letter, form, treatment summary, or other documentation for a third party, please ask in advance.

### What is a Good Faith Estimate?

Under the No Surprises Act you have the right to a written estimate of expected costs before beginning care with a private-pay provider. Ask and I will provide one.

### How many sessions will I need?

I cannot tell you before we start, and I would be suspicious of anyone who could. We set goals at the beginning and review against them rather than continuing by default.

### Where do you practice?

Secure video only, for adults physically located in Kentucky or Ohio at the time of the session.

### Do you work with children, teenagers, couples or families?

Not at this time.

### What happens in a consultation?

We talk about what you are struggling with and how you would like your life to be different. You can ask whatever you would like, and we will determine whether we are a good fit. There is no obligation to book an appointment after the consultation.

### Is ART right for everyone?

No. ART is not the right fit for every person or every issue. During the consultation, we will discuss what you are struggling with and whether ART, or another therapeutic approach with me, may be the best fit.

This practice is not a crisis or emergency service, and messages are not monitored around the clock. If you are in immediate danger, experiencing a mental health emergency, or having thoughts of ending your life with intent or a plan, call or text 988 (Suicide & Crisis Lifeline), call 911, or go to your nearest emergency room for an assessment. Veterans can press 1 after dialing 988.
